Exploring Diverse Types of Boat Rentals
When evaluating a boat rental, it is crucial to understand the numerous types available. Different boats serve distinct purposes, catering to diverse preferences and activities. For example, motorboats are well-suited for speed enthusiasts and those seeking quick travel across water. Sailboats, on the other hand, appeal to those who appreciate a more relaxed pace, embracing the art of sailing while harnessing the wind.
For fishing aficionados, fishing boats feature essential gear, guaranteeing a successful day on the water. Pontoon boats deliver spaciousness and comfort, making them perfect for family outings or social gatherings. Kayaks and canoes present a more intimate connection with nature, ideal for exploring tranquil lakes and rivers. Each type of boat rental presents unique experiences, enabling individuals to decide based on their interests, group size, and intended activities, ultimately elevating their adventure on the water.

Essential Safety Matters When Renting a Boat
Before starting a boating excursion, it is important for renters to prioritize safety to ensure an enjoyable experience on the water. Renters should commence by comprehensively checking the boat's safety equipment, including life jackets, flares, and fire extinguishers. Making sure that all safety gear is in excellent condition and readily accessible is vital.
Additionally, understanding local boating rules and weather conditions is vital. Renters must understand navigation requirements and any specific rules for the region they will be exploring. A pre-departure safety orientation from the rental company can provide valuable guidance.
It's furthermore advisable to inform someone on land about the scheduled path and anticipated arrival time. Furthermore, renters should think about enrolling in a boating safety course, as it equips individuals with critical competencies and knowledge to handle unexpected situations effectively. Highlighting these safety protocols will enrich the overall boating experience.

What Types of Insurance Do I Need for Boat Rentals?
When renting a boat, renters usually need liability insurance, which covers damages to third parties, and may consider optional insurance for personal property and collision damage. It is advisable to check with rental companies for specific requirements.
